ICD-Code T81: Complications of procedures, not elsewhere classified
- T81.0 Haemorrhage and haematoma complicating a procedure, not elsewhere classified
- T81.1 Shock during or resulting from a procedure, not elsewhere classified
- T81.2 Accidental puncture or laceration during a procedure, not elsewhere classified
- T81.3 Disruption of operation wound, not elsewhere classified
- T81.4 Infection following a procedure, not elsewhere classified
- T81.5 Foreign body accidentally left in body cavity or operation wound following a procedure
- T81.6 Acute reaction to foreign substance accidentally left during a procedure
- T81.7 Vascular complications following a procedure, not elsewhere classified
- T81.8 Other complications of procedures, not elsewhere classified
- T81.9 Unspecified complication of procedure
Note
In outpatient care, the ICD code on medical documents is always appended with a diagnostic confidence indicator (A, G, V or Z): A (excluded diagnosis), G (confirmed diagnosis), V (tentative diagnosis) and Z (condition after a confirmed diagnosis).
